How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 92629?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 92629 Studio Apartments | $2,800 | $2,800 | $2,800 |
| 92629 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,712 | $1,850 | $11,584 |
| 92629 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,222 | $2,150 | $14,387 |
| 92629 3 Bedroom Apartments | $9,567 | $3,750 | $17,000 |
